    Hi all.
    I've just received my list of charges (£437) from Smile and am about to ask them for my money back. I just wondered if it is ok to send my request for the refund of charges by secure message or is recorded delivery the best option? Also, I calculated that they have had another £100 approx in interesticon from me. Should I ask for both straight away or maybe agree to let them off with the interest of they settle up quickly, ie, 'If you cough up the charges straight away, I'll forget about the interest'?
    Any advice appreciated.

    Hi Deek,

    I'd advise sending your prelim and lbaicon by recorded (or special) delivery.

    With regards to the interest, is this the general overdrafticon interest applied to your account? If you've worked out the interest properly and it forms part of your claim, I'd be inclined to say go for the full amount as opposed to offering to reduce for a quicker settlement. If it's the s69 8% interest - this can't be reclaimed at prelim/LBA stages as it can only be awarded by the courts.

    Hope this helps, best of luck
